WebA deed poll is a legal document that proves a change of name. You can change any part of your name, add or remove names and hyphens, or change spelling. There are 2 ways to get a deed poll. You can either: make an ‘unenrolled’ deed poll yourself. apply for an ‘enrolled’ deed poll. Ask the organisation you’re dealing with (for example ... You must accept them as evidence of a … WebOct 7, 2024 · An unenrolled Deed Poll is accepted by all UK businesses and organisations, as long as it’s worded correctly and has been executed in the right way, too. This means: two witnesses have signed the Deed along with you they meet the guidelines for a witness you’ve signed the Deed in their presence the wording of the Deed is legally valid

WebMay 27, 2024 · There are two types of Deed Poll or Change of Name Deed, unenrolled and enrolled. Unenrolled simply means that the document is not registered with the Royal Courts of Justice and the name change does not appear on public record. ... for example, surnames ending with OBE or VC is a single name — that is, a first name only, with no surname .
